Bovine -Casein Peptide YPFPGPIH Regulates Inflammation and Macrophage Activity via TLRNF-BMAPK Signaling
Food-derived bioactive peptides are known to possess immunomodulatory properties, although their molecular mechanisms remain incompletely characterized. In this study, we investigated the immunoregulatory effects and underlying mechanisms of YPFPGPIH, a peptide derived from bovine β-casein, using the RAW264.7 macrophage model.
